Abstract

The present application provides a multi-source satellite cooperative-based atmospheric carbon monoxide plume identification and quantification method, comprising: training a ViT model using TROPOMI data to realize global CO plume intelligent rough screening, and generating a first-level mask by SAM after detecting an event; introducing GaoFen-5 AHSI data for a first-level event, performing matching filtering to invert a CO enhancement field and driving SAM to generate a second-level mask; introducing WorldView-3 data for a second-level event, inverting a CO enhancement field through a logarithmic radiation ratio and driving SAM to generate a third-level mask. Finally, according to the resolution of each level of satellite, the IME method is used to estimate the emission rate of each level of point source. The present application constructs a three-level cooperative automatic detection system of 'global scanning-regional detailed investigation-local precise investigation', effectively improves the automation level and attribution ability of CO point source detection, and is suitable for emission verification of key industries and facilities.
